A rebar is a steel bar that is used in the concrete to provide extra strength to the structure. Higher diameter represents higher strength and the weight of that rebar is also high and lower diameter rebar is used in the light structures for light uses. Carbon steel rebar. No major substrate renovations are required when installing an extensive green roof, although additional structural support may be required. This is because they can add significant weight—ranging from 68 to 272 kg (150 to 600 lb) per square foot—due to the soil, vegetation, and water retention systems.

A raft foundation , also called a raft foundation , is essentially a continuous slab resting on the soil that extends over the entire footprint of the building, thereby supporting the building and transferring its weight to the ground. . Further, earth retaining structures can also be classified under heavy foundations.
